Esempio n. 1
0
    def edit(self):
        c = TemplateContext()
        c.heading = _('Edit preferences')
        c.formDisabled = ''

        try:
            member = self.session.get('user')
            c.member = member
            pref = self.db.query(Preferences).filter(
                Preferences.uidNumber == member.uidNumber).all()

            c.language = 'en'

            if len(pref) > 0:
                for p in pref:
                    if p.key == 'language':
                        c.language = p.value

            c.languages = Config.get('mematool', 'languages', ['en'])

            return self.render('preferences/edit.mako', template_context=c)

        except LookupError:
            print 'Edit :: No such user !'

        return 'ERROR 4x0'
Esempio n. 2
0
  def edit(self):
    c = TemplateContext()
    c.heading = _('Edit preferences')
    c.formDisabled = ''

    try:
      member = self.session.get('user')
      c.member = member
      pref = self.db.query(Preferences).filter(Preferences.uidNumber == member.uidNumber).all()

      c.language = 'en'

      if len(pref) > 0:
        for p in pref:
          if p.key == 'language':
            c.language = p.value

      c.languages = Config.get('mematool', 'languages', ['en'])

      return self.render('preferences/edit.mako', template_context=c)

    except LookupError:
      print 'Edit :: No such user !'

    return 'ERROR 4x0'